FindOpenMP: Cleanup all variables unconditionally
This commit is contained in:
parent
ec963f04cb
commit
8f1103c0fd
@ -186,7 +186,6 @@ if(CMAKE_CXX_COMPILER_LOADED)
|
|||||||
|
|
||||||
list(APPEND _OPENMP_REQUIRED_VARS OpenMP_CXX_FLAGS)
|
list(APPEND _OPENMP_REQUIRED_VARS OpenMP_CXX_FLAGS)
|
||||||
unset(OpenMP_CXX_FLAG_CANDIDATES)
|
unset(OpenMP_CXX_FLAG_CANDIDATES)
|
||||||
unset(OpenMP_CXX_TEST_SOURCE)
|
|
||||||
endif()
|
endif()
|
||||||
|
|
||||||
# check Fortran compiler
|
# check Fortran compiler
|
||||||
@ -220,7 +219,6 @@ if(CMAKE_Fortran_COMPILER_LOADED)
|
|||||||
|
|
||||||
list(APPEND _OPENMP_REQUIRED_VARS OpenMP_Fortran_FLAGS)
|
list(APPEND _OPENMP_REQUIRED_VARS OpenMP_Fortran_FLAGS)
|
||||||
unset(OpenMP_Fortran_FLAG_CANDIDATES)
|
unset(OpenMP_Fortran_FLAG_CANDIDATES)
|
||||||
unset(OpenMP_Fortran_TEST_SOURCE)
|
|
||||||
endif()
|
endif()
|
||||||
|
|
||||||
set(CMAKE_REQUIRED_QUIET ${CMAKE_REQUIRED_QUIET_SAVE})
|
set(CMAKE_REQUIRED_QUIET ${CMAKE_REQUIRED_QUIET_SAVE})
|
||||||
@ -237,3 +235,7 @@ if(_OPENMP_REQUIRED_VARS)
|
|||||||
else()
|
else()
|
||||||
message(SEND_ERROR "FindOpenMP requires C or CXX language to be enabled")
|
message(SEND_ERROR "FindOpenMP requires C or CXX language to be enabled")
|
||||||
endif()
|
endif()
|
||||||
|
|
||||||
|
unset(OpenMP_C_TEST_SOURCE)
|
||||||
|
unset(OpenMP_CXX_TEST_SOURCE)
|
||||||
|
unset(OpenMP_Fortran_TEST_SOURCE)
|
||||||
|
Loading…
x
Reference in New Issue
Block a user